Crate training puppies

Crate training is the process of teaching your puppy to see their crate as a safe and comfortable place to be. Crate training can be used to house train your puppy, prevent them from being destructive, and help them feel more secure.

House training: Crate training can help you house train your puppy more quickly and easily. Puppies are less likely to soil their crate than they are other areas of your home.

When choosing a crate for your puppy, make sure that it is large enough for them to stand up and turn around comfortably. The crate should also have a sturdy door and be made of durable materials.

Start by leaving the crate door open and placing some treats or toys inside. This will help your puppy to associate the crate with positive things.

Once your puppy is house trained and can be trusted not to be destructive, you can start to phase out crate training. However, it is important to keep the crate available as a safe and secure place for your puppy to retreat to when needed.

Feed your puppy in their crate. This will help them to associate the crate with positive things.Use the crate for naps and bedtime. This will help your puppy to learn that the crate is a safe and comfortable place to rest.
